Ukraine: Russisk skyggeflåde er vokset

Siden de vestlige lande i 2022 indførte et prisloft på 60 dollar per tønde russisk råolie, for at bremse landets olieeksport, har russerne investeret 10 milliarder dollar i en udvidelse af den såkaldte skyggeflåde, der i dag står for 70 procent af russernes skibsbaserede olieeksport.

Det fremgår af en ny analyse, udarbejdet af den ukrainske tænketank Kyiv School of Economics.

Ifølge tænketanken er den mængde olie skyggeflåden transporterer vokset fra 2,4 millioner tønder om dagen, til nu 4,1 millioner tønder om dagen.

Skyggeflådens foretrukne rute går gennem de danske stræder. I gennemsnit passerer tæt på 3 skyggeflåde tankskibe med tvivlsomme ejer- og forsikringsforhold dansk farvand hver dag året rundt.

Danmark vil lige som EU rigtig gerne stoppe skyggeflådens brug af dansk farvand, men internationale traktater gør det meget vanskeligt for Danmark at gribe ind over skyggeflåden.
